A conceptually simple and practically very useful form of data abstraction in model checking is variable hiding, which amounts to suppressing all information about a given set of variables. The abC tool automates this for programs written in the C programming language. It features an integrated demand-driven pointer analysis, and has been implemented as an extension of GCC.
